misterp Posted August 20, 2006 Report Share Posted August 20, 2006 A shame - that thing's a ridiculously overpriced DOG, there's now way I can see of recouping $15-grand through parting it out. And it'll never be at it's full value again - it's now legally crippled with a SALVAGED TITLE, even fixed-up mint it's a carfax bastard child so no it's not worth $24K. I think $15.5K is too much for it, if it had a clear title I would feel different; I had a '99 Expedition 4x4 receive almost the same exact damage (frame bent ahead of steering box) and it required a replacement frame, new front clip, and paint - that was a $8500 job and I bet the SS pictured here is going to require nearly the same. They need to get the price WAY down, like around $10K and then it would be worth making a project out of. Mr. P.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

Simon Posted August 22, 2006 Report Share Posted August 22, 2006 Here's the way I see it: hood 300$ fender 150$ head+flasher 200$ bumber 300$ grill 200$ wheel 200$ windshield 250$ installed airbag 200$ airbag module or reprogram 50$ rad support 100$ radiator 300$ frame work 800$ body work 1000$ total 4200$ plus all the other things you didn't expect and the inspection You've got to know somebody in the autobody business or you'll be taken care of !!! total would be 19000$ I was happy to save 2000$ when i bought mine, but I bought it repaired. It's all up to you, the truck looks nice too. Hope this helps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
